Frequently Asked Questions About Backflow Testing in Carol City
Many municipalities in Florida require annual backflow testing for commercial and residential properties with backflow prevention devices. Your local water authority in Carol City can confirm the exact testing schedule and deadlines for your area. Failing to test on time may result in fines or water service interruption.
Some certified testers near Carol City offer same-day or emergency scheduling for urgent situations such as a failed device, a compliance deadline, or a new construction inspection. Look for testers with active state certification, strong Google reviews, and experience with your type of backflow preventer (PVB, DCVA, or RPZ). RPZ (Reduced Pressure Zone) testing verifies that your reduced pressure backflow preventer is functioning correctly to protect your water supply from contamination. A certified tester uses specialized gauges to measure differential pressures across the assembly. RPZ devices are typically required for high-hazard connections.
Most jurisdictions in Florida require backflow testers to hold a current certification from an approved training program, typically involving classroom instruction, a hands-on practical exam, and continuing education credits. Some municipalities maintain their own approved-tester lists. Always verify certification before hiring.
